Nairobi
April 3, 2017
The World Bank’s Nairobi office organized and hosted an informal discussion of the WDR 2018 with government and civil society organization representatives. A WDR Team Member presented the main themes of the WDR 2018 which was followed by a Q&A session.

Berlin
November 16, 2016
The Development Policy Forum of the Deutsche Gesellschaft für Internationale Zusammenarbeit (GIZ) GmbH, on behalf of the World Bank and the German Federal Ministry for Economic Cooperation and Development (BMZ), organized a one-day workshop to discuss the themes of the WDR 2018. The WDR Co-Directors presented an overview of the themes of the WDR 2018, heard discussants’ comments, and then took questions and comments from the participants. This was followed by sessions where WDR Team Members separately made more in-depth presentations, heard discussants’ comments, and took questions and comments related to specific themes. Participants included government officials, as well as representatives from non-government organizations, civil society organizations, and academics and researchers.
